      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Collect medical records according to tight timeframes and facilitate storage in secure repositories
      - Contact provider offices to request copies of medical records and coordinate efficient retrieval methods
      - Perform research and investigation to ensure successful record retrieval, troubleshooting issues as they arise
      - Travel to provider offices, medical facilities, or employer campus to obtain and prepare medical records
      - Communicate effectively with team members and external healthcare providers to meet project deadlines

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- 5 years of prior healthcare or health insurance experience
      - Proficiency in Microsoft Office Tools: Outlook, Excel, Word, Vision
      - Completion of all necessary access requirements and forms for record retrieval
      - Associates in health Information Technology or relevant experience in lieu of a degree
      - Strong verbal and written communication skills

      How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
      - Experience and familiarity with medical records, medical terminology, and Electronic Medical Record (EMR) or Electronic Health Record (EHR) systems
      - Proficiency in navigating and retrieving clinical information from EMR/EHR systems
      - Working knowledge of HIPAA requirements and commitment to privacy and security
